00000000000001c Hi everyone! Week 4 is underway. The results speak for themselves—take a look! 🌱😄 Update – July 21 Today (July 21) I topped up the soil, bringing each pot to approximately 15 L. I also watered each plant with 1.5 L of water mixed with BioBizz Bio-Grow. Everything is looking healthy so far, and the plants are responding well. 🌱💚 📅 July 22 🌱 Today I did some LST to help improve light penetration and encourage even growth. ✨ As you can see, Northern Sun – Soure Rot Candy is already entering the pre-flower stage and looks absolutely beautiful! 😍 Healthy, vigorous, and developing exactly as I hoped. 💚 🌿 Fast Buds – Frostbanger is still a compact little lady, but she's incredibly pretty and looks very healthy. 💪 I raised her so she's now roughly at the same height as the Northern Sun, giving both plants more even light exposure. ☀️ 💡 The distance from the canopy to the light is now 40 cm. So far, everything is going great! 🤞🌱💚

00000000000001c The first week of flowering is over, there was the first feeding with nutrients at 0.5g/l, a day after that watering with water. And two days later, watering with nutrients at 0.7g/l, the plant reacted normally, burned the lower leaves due to carelessness while watering..) Northern Sun has so many buds😮😮😮 Frostbanger is acquiring a purple hue, looks beautiful.

00000000000001c The second week has come to an end, and this week I used fertilizer twice, alternating with water. The Frostbanger is already noticeably all purple, a beautiful plant. I removed the lower leaves that I burned last time to make it easier to water (I didn't think about this during veg). From the leaves, I can see that there's not enough Nitrogen, correct me if I'm wrong? But it looks just 😍😍😍
